Overview & Identity
Kentucky Christian University is a private nonprofit institution located in the town setting of Grayson, KY. The university supports an undergraduate student body of 429 students and has an admission acceptance rate of 61%.

Tuition & Cost Portrait
Avg Net Price$24,038
In-State Tuition$26,625
Out-of-State Tuition$26,625
Net Price DifferentiatorAverage Net Price is what typical families actually pay out of pocket after receiving federal, state, and institutional grants and scholarships. It provides a more accurate metric of affordability than the sticker tuition.
